Overview of A4 Paper
Before diving into the manufacturing procedure, it is very important to understand what A4 paper is. At first standardized by the International Organization for Standardization (ISO), A4 paper measures 210 x 297 mm (8.27 x 11.69 inches) and is extensively used for various applications ranging from printing files to crafting.

The Manufacturing Process
The manufacturing of A4 paper includes several crucial actions that transform raw products into the finished product. Comprehending these processes reveals the intricacies associated with producing a seemingly basic sheet of paper.
1. Basic Material Sourcing
The main raw materials used in A4 paper production are wood pulp or recycled paper. Makers typically source timber from sustainable forests to ensure very little environmental impact.
2. Pulping Process
The sourced wood is then processed into pulp. There are 2 main pulping approaches:
- Mechanical Pulping: Involves grinding wood logs to different fibers. This approach is cheaper however may lead to lower paper quality.
- Chemical Pulping: Utilizes chemicals to dissolve lignin, separating fibers more effectively. It produces greater quality pulp however is costlier.
3. Mixing and Refining
In this stage, the pulp is mixed with ingredients such as fillers, colorants, and sizing agents. The mix is fine-tuned to enhance fiber bonding and develop the desired paper residential or commercial properties, such as opacity and smoothness.
4. Sheet Formation
The refined pulp is spread out onto a mesh screen to form sheets. The water is drained pipes, and the pulp begins to take the shape of the paper. This procedure requires accuracy to ensure a consistent density.
5. Drying
The formed sheets are travelled through heated rollers to eliminate excess moisture. This step is vital for attaining the last texture and quality of the paper.
6. Ending up
After drying, the paper goes through various ending up procedures, such as calendaring and cutting. The paper is then cut to A4 measurements, packaged, and prepared for shipment.
7. Quality assurance
Throughout the production process, quality control procedures are carried out to make sure the last item fulfills market standards. This includes testing for thickness, brightness, and tensile strength.
Sustainability in Paper Manufacturing
As environmental awareness increases, A4 paper makers are adopting sustainable practices. Here are some essential efforts:
- Sourcing from Sustainable Forests: Many producers are dedicated to sourcing wood from forests accredited by organizations like the Forest Stewardship Council (FSC).
- Using Recycled Materials: Increased use of recycled paper decreases the need for virgin pulp, reducing logging and energy use.
- Energy Efficient Processes: Manufacturers are purchasing energy-efficient equipment and processes to minimize their carbon footprint.
- Water Conservation: Implementing closed-loop water systems assists in recycling water used in the production procedure.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
What is A4 paper mostly utilized for?
A4 paper is frequently used for printing files, producing notebooks, and numerous arts and crafts. It is the basic size for official letter writing in many countries.
How is A4 paper graded?
A4 paper is graded based on its weight (measured in grams per square meter or gsm), texture, brightness, and opacity. Common weights include 70gsm, 80gsm, and 100gsm.
Is A4 paper recyclable?
Yes, A4 paper is recyclable. Numerous producers produce recycled A4 paper from post-consumer waste, which conserves resources and lowers ecological effect.
What is the distinction in between A4 and Letter paper?
The main distinction lies in their measurements. A4 Paper Bundle measures 210 x 297 mm, while Letter paper measures 216 x 279 mm. A4 is utilized widely in many countries, while Letter paper prevails in the United States.

How can I choose the ideal A4 paper for my requirements?
Consider the paper weight, brightness, and surface based on your meant usage. For expert files, choose heavier, brighter paper; for everyday printing, basic 80gsm paper can suffice.
